Responsibilities- Managing a caseload of lien files which involves rating the permanent disability under the AMA guides, reviewing medical records, understanding apportionment, completing settlement documents, and resolving liens
- Performing lien negotiations and legal representations
- Appearing before a judge for Mandatory Settlement Conferences, Status Conferences, and walking through settlements
- Providing timely communication with clients and written summaries on a routine basis
